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 9 -- United States Patent no. 12,649,552, issued on June 9, was assigned to University of Massachusetts (Boston).

"Autonomous submersible sensor apparatus with piston dive control" was invented by Patrick R. Pasteris (Swansea, Mass.).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A lightweight, efficient, autonomous sub-surface water data profiler (10) that can be easily programmed and deployed to collect sample data at a variety of water depths is disclosed.
